The Bucket Bag – Spring’s New “IT” Bag

If I’m being completely honest, the bucket bag is the one handbag style I haven’t fallen totally in love with. It was just always a style that seemed clunky to me.  Boy was I wrong.

My “A-Ha” moment with the bucket bag came when chatting with Jordan Reid from Ramshackle Glam at last weekends DKNY shopping event. The bucket bag came up and I mentioned its the one style I don’t own.  I just couldn’t take my eye off the geometric print bucket bag from DKNY’s spring collection. Taking the plunge I purchased the bag and then headed home to do some research about this bag and quickly found that it seems to be this season’s “IT” bag.

So which ones should you spend your hand earned money on and welcome into your handbag wardrobe?  Check out my picks for the top bucket bags for Spring 2015.

Snob Essentials “Andie” Handbag

I’ve been a fan of the Snob Essentials handbag line since it debuted last year, so naturally when I look for budget friendly bag, I look to Tina and Kelly.  The “Andie” bag is their bucket bag for the spring, is under $100, and comes in six color combos (my favorite is the soft pink).

Dooney & Bourke Nylon Drawstring in Mint

Mint is such a fresh color for spring so why not use this fun bucket bag to add a pop of color to your look?

DKNY Geo Print Bucket Bag

This is the one that I purchased. I love the geo-print and the pop of color in the red handle/straps. Keep an eye for how I style it with other pieces in my wardrobe.

Rebecca Minkoff Moto Bucket Bag

Perforated leather automatically adds a bit of edge to a look. Naturally I look to Rebecca Minkoff to supply me with a bag that looks effortlessly cool.

Kate Spade Kacey Lane Small Poppy Bucket Bag

Kate Spade Kacey Lane Small Poppy Bucket Bag

Who doesn’t love a mini bucket bag? Plus, everyone always needs a basic black handbag.
